If you’ve ever read a book on leadership, there’s a good chance it was written by John Maxwell. He’s sold more than 35 million books, and he’s spent decades teaching one core idea: everything rises and falls on leadership. Both my wife Tracy and I have learned from him, so getting to meet him was a real privilege.

Maxwell’s most famous line is that leadership is influence: nothing more, nothing less. Not your title. Not the size of your office. Influence: whether people choose to follow you when they don’t have to.
